Cloud-top seeding is usually performed between the temperatures of -5°C and -10°C. The greatest amount of super-cooled liquid water is usually found within this range. This corresponds to an altitude range of 15,000 to 22,000 ft depending upon location. Dropping or ejecting silver iodide flares into the growing cloud turrets dispenses seeding agent. The seeding agent is placed into the super-cooled clouds where nucleation is desired, so the updrafts in these cases are relied upon only to provide a continuing source of condensate. This delivery technique requires less anticipation on the part of those directing the seeding operations and may have a more immediate effect.
